splunk db connect 3:Why am I getting this error trying to connect Splunk on Linux to on a Windows machine?

I get the following error when trying to connect Splunk db connect 3.1 on Linux to on a Windows machine
Database connection xxxx is invalid.
The TCP/IP connection to the host hostname, port 1433 has failed. Error: "null. Verify the connection properties. Make sure that an instance of SQL Server is running on the host and accepting TCP/IP connections at the port. Make sure that TCP connections to the port are not blocked by a firewall.".

Can you telnet to the SQL server on port 1433 from the server that is running db connect? If not, check your network firewall or host firewalls.
